Output ec9d9024a869825ccbc1d3aaf1886b3b23a11b3a21a9a75338aa7971ac478739:3

value
81623048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4f125b296185fce9a65a3795e18f24eaae7063e OP_EQUAL
address
MNwHw6VT1fZoXxqvr2bhrFJygohRUXifZu
transaction
ec9d9024a869825ccbc1d3aaf1886b3b23a11b3a21a9a75338aa7971ac478739
spent
true